Riyadh-based Alex Malouf is a marketing communications executive and expert who has spent the last two decades in the Middle East. A journalist by training, and with a cultural mix that is both European and Arabic, Alex's expertise spans communications and media, public relations, and marketing. He has led communications for multinationals in the digital, electric mobility, energy, sustainability, technology, and fast-moving consumer goods space, while also advising ministers and entities in the Gulf's government sector.
An entrepreneur in his own right (along with his wife, Alex founded the first business-to-business magazines in Saudi Arabia), Alex's experience includes corporate communications, media relations and outreach, content development, crisis/ reputation management, and digital/social media. When he's not putting pen to paper, Alex can be found advocating for the region's media and public relations industry as the best way to tell the region's story and build national brands.
